About This Book
Dying and Death: Getting Rightly Prepared for the Inevitable provides thoughtful preparation for one of life's most certain events. Authors Beeke Joel and Christopher Bogosh draw on their expertise to address the emotional, spiritual, and practical aspects of mortality.
The book emphasizes the importance of getting ready through reflection and planning. It guides readers in considering how to approach death with grace and understanding.
With a focus on inevitable outcomes, the content encourages proactive steps toward acceptance and readiness. This resource serves as a compassionate companion for individuals and families navigating end-of-life matters.
Overall, it aims to foster a mindset of preparedness that honors the human experience from beginning to end.
